Waste Production from Throwaway Vapes


The surge in demand of disposable vapes has led to a significant growth in refuse production. Each product is designed for single use, which includes a battery, e-liquid, and multiple synthetics that contribute to its ecological impact. As users prefer the convenience of throwaway options, millions of these devices end up in dump sites every year, adding to a growing refuse problem.


Many single-use vapes are not thrown out properly, exacerbating the problem. When discarded irresponsibly, they can contaminate the surroundings, releasing harmful chemicals into earth and water sources. Additionally, the components in these devices, such as rechargeable batteries and polymer, are not biodegradable. This means that even when they are not readily visible, the environmental impact can last for a long time, posing a risk to fauna and natural environments.


Efforts to reuse or securely throw away throwaway vapes are still in their infancy. While some businesses have launched reclamation programs, these are not commonly implemented. The lack of proper reprocessing options means that many consumers do not understand how to get rid of their e-cigarettes correctly. As knowledge grows, it becomes vital to create more green methods for handling the refuse generated by these devices, ensuring that the environmental footprint is lessened.


Pollution from Chemicals and Impact


The growing popularity of throwaway vapes has led to a notable rise in toxic pollution. These products contain multiple substances such as nicotine-based compounds, propylene glycol, and flavoring compounds. When thrown out improperly, they can leak these chemicals into the environment, contaminating soil and water sources. Over time, this pollution can impact local ecosystems, endangering plant and animal life.


Furthermore, the elements of disposable vapes, particularly the batteries, pose a substantial risk of chemical leakage. Li-ion batteries can leak toxic metals like lead compounds and cadmium if they are not disposed of correctly. These metals can enter the food supply, impacting human health as well. Communities near inadequate disposal sites may experience dealing with long-term health effects as a result of these toxins.


Additionally, the presence of harmful chemicals in the environment can disrupt the delicate balance of ecosystems. Pollutants can lead to decreased biodiversity as sensitive species might be pushed out from their habitats. This disruption can have knock-on effects, modifying food webs and affecting the overall health of ecosystems, which are crucial for maintaining a balanced environment.
